"Portuguese People Are Facing Difficulties because of Fuel Costs"

At a point when public opinion is rounding on the government over the level of taxation it applies to fuel products, Minister of Economy and Territorial Cohesion, Manuel Castro Almeida,

The Minister of Economy and Territorial Cohesion, Manuel Castro Almeida, considered today that inflation is not going well and admitted that the Portuguese are going through difficulties because of the extraordinary increase in fuels.

Manuel Castro Almeida considered the issue of fuels "a delicate point"

Manuel Castro Almeida argues that the country is improving, but has refused a too optimistic view of the government.

Manuel Castro Almeida admitted that "the Portuguese are experiencing difficulties because of this extraordinary increase in fuel costs"
